  • Basic information

    1. Product Name: 1,4-Dioxino[2,3-f]quinolin-10(7H)-one, 9-chloro-2,3-dihydro-
    2. Synonyms: 1,4-Dioxino[2,3-f]quinolin-10(7H)-one, 9-chloro-2,3-dihydro-
    3. CAS NO:642478-16-8
    4. Molecular Formula: C11H8ClNO3
    5. Molecular Weight: 237.64

642478-16-8 Usage

Chemical Class

Dioxinoquinolones

Explanation

The compound belongs to a class of heterocyclic compounds known as dioxinoquinolones.

Explanation

The unique molecular structure of the compound consists of a dioxane ring fused to a quinolin-10-one ring system, which contributes to its chemical properties.

Explanation

The presence of a chlorine atom in the 9th position of the 2,3-dihydro-quinoline part of the molecule gives the compound its characteristic properties and influences its reactivity.

Check Digit Verification of cas no

The CAS Registry Mumber 642478-16-8 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 6,4,2,4,7 and 8 respectively; the second part has 2 digits, 1 and 6 respectively.
Calculate Digit Verification of CAS Registry Number 642478-16:
(8*6)+(7*4)+(6*2)+(5*4)+(4*7)+(3*8)+(2*1)+(1*6)=168
168 % 10 = 8
So 642478-16-8 is a valid CAS Registry Number.
